摘要
以平邑甜茶继代组培苗为试材,研究了NAA、IBA、ZT和6-BA作用下组培苗的生长、内源多胺(PAs)和一氧化氮(NO)含量的变化。结果表明,在MS培养基中添加0.02~1.00mg.L-1的NAA或IBA后,外植体鲜样质量增加率和蛋白质含量以及多胺含量和一氧化氮含量均明显增加,其中浓度在0.10~0.50mg.L-1时增加最高;同样浓度下,NAA处理的外植体鲜样质量增加率和腐胺含量高于IBA。在0.08~4.00mg.L-1范围内,随着ZT或6-BA浓度的升高,外植体鲜样质量增加率、可溶性蛋白含量、多胺含量和一氧化氮含量均逐渐升高;同样浓度下,6-BA处理的外植体鲜样质量增率和腐胺含量高于ZT。生长素和细胞分裂素促进组培苗生长与促进内源PAs和NO的生成相伴随,组培苗生长动态与内源多胺和一氧化氮含量的变化趋势一致。
